Eligibility Criteria for the Police Officer Employment Application

Before applying for police officer positions, candidates must meet specific eligibility criteria. Typical requirements often include age restrictions, citizenship status, and educational qualifications. Each law enforcement agency may have unique standards; thus, variations could exist based on state-specific regulations.
Common eligibility criteria may include:
  • Minimum age requirement (often 21 years)
  • U.S. citizenship or permanent residency
  • Completion of a high school diploma or equivalent
  • No felony convictions
  • Valid driver's license

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them

Many applicants may encounter pitfalls while completing the police officer employment application. Common errors include providing inaccurate information or leaving sections incomplete. To ensure a successful submission, it is essential to double-check each part of the application before sending it off.
Here are some tips on how to avoid common mistakes:
  • Verify all personal information is current and correctly spelled.
  • Review the application for any missing sections.
  • Ensure that all answers are consistent and reflect the same information throughout.
  • Have a trusted person review your application before submission.
